Criminal Justice Program Director Job Description

Generations College is seeking a highly qualified Criminal Justice Program Director to lead our Criminal Justice program. The successful candidate will be responsible for ensuring the quality of the program and providing a model of teaching excellence that supports the mission, vision, and values of the College.

Responsibilities:
  • Teach 15 credit hours in the Fall, Spring, and Summer semesters.
  • Recruit, hire, supervise, and evaluate adjunct faculty in the program.
  • Research, develop, and implement new related programs that advance student knowledge and career prospects.
  • Assign faculty to specific courses each semester.
  • Provide the College's syllabus template to each adjunct faculty member and collect and review syllabi for all program courses.
  • Map curriculum to program outcomes and College competencies and ensure that course syllabi specify how courses meet outcomes and competencies.
  • Conduct regular assessment of courses and program outcomes, make improvements based on assessment data, and record data-based improvements in annual assessment reports.
  • Implement the program strategic plans, review the strategic plan annually, and recommend updates as needed based on new data.
  • Participate in student orientation, admissions events, staff meetings, and retreats.
  • Maintain standards for HLC accreditation and participate in institutional reaccreditation process.
  • Remain professionally active in discipline and in teaching and learning.
  • Lead discipline-specific accreditation and implementation of best practices in the program.
  • Develop and maintain an active advisory board and/or community feedback mechanism.
  • Work with the Dean of Academic Affairs to provide professional development for adjunct faculty.
  • Review program marketing materials.
  • Develop appropriate experiential learning opportunities for students in their area.
  • Meet with students who have academic issues that have not been resolved through discussions with instructors.
  • Provide Criminal Justice students with academic advising and career guidance.
Qualifications:
  • A Master's Degree in Criminal Justice, Criminology, or equivalent.
  • Prior Criminal Justice teaching experience.
  • Model and serve as a leader within the existing Generation College's culture of great integrity, innovation, persistence, advancement, hard work, collaboration, diversity, and community.
